Grasse: Launch of the BioPreserv business within InnovaGrasse

BioPreserv is a biology/analytical chemistry laboratory dedicated to the fields of biocides and antimicrobial R&D


Interview with Thierry LACOUR (TL) PhD biotechnology

 

Investincotedazur.com (ICA): Can you tell us more about your company?

TL: We are two founders from the same major international group (Rohm and Haas / Dow Chemical). Inspired by our previous roles, BioPreserv’s business is focused on technical and regulatory support for users, producers of finished products (cosmetics, detergents, construction materials) and producers and distributors of biocides.

 

ICA: What are the specific characteristics of your offer?

TL: We primarily provide our clients with several decades of experience in research and development as well as regulation in an industrial and international environment. BioPreserv is both a biology and analytical chemistry laboratory and an expert service in regulation.

We provide a turn-key service and help our clients to combine texts and define the experimental protocol to customise their projects. With a single contact who coordinates all three services (biology, analytical chemistry and regulation), our clients therefore get the necessary reactivity and accuracy to resolve or prevent contamination problems in their products in reduced timeframes.

 

ICA: You have set up your business within the InnovaGrasse incubator for innovative companies, what are the advantages of joining this type of organisation?  

TL: The incubator provides good momentum for growth with real support. Every month there are themed workshops.

Furthermore, we have an office and also a laboratory available to us. The proximity with the fine chemistry school helps to create true professional gateways. The students who work here can collaborate on projects.

 

ICA: What contact do you have with the competitiveness clusters, research laboratories, etc.?

TL: BioPreserv’s activity in microbiology and REACH/biocide regulations in Europe is our core business and fully consistent with the PASS cluster’s remit (Perfumes, Fragrances, Flavours), of which I am a member.

BioPreserv is also supported by the PACA EST business incubator and develops partnerships on research projects with a university laboratory

 

ICA: What are your development prospects?

TL: The implementation of European regulations in various business sectors forces manufacturers to find new solutions to ensure the microbiological protection of their products. So, in the cosmetics sector, the project to ban parabens and phthalates means the unavoidable reformulation of many products. BioPreserv has the necessary expertise to assist manufacturers who have to deal with the constant changes resulting from these European regulations.

"Sophia-Antipolis is a very attractive region for any semiconductor company, for several reasons. The first one is that in the technology park of Sophia-Antipolis there is a solid tradition of analog and digital design, which is due to the presence of other big companies working in the same or similar markets, like Texas Instruments, Intel, STM and others. The second reason is linked to presence in the technology park of the Polytech'Nice-Sophia and other important schools.

That will guarantee our future growth since the region will always offer both experienced design engineers and you talents to hire."

Interview with Paolo Cusinato, Design Director of MAXIM Sophia-Antipolis design center
